Форум русскоязычного сообщества Ubuntu


Считаете, что Ubuntu недостаточно дружелюбна к новичкам?
Помогите создать новое Руководство для новичков!

Автор Тема: Ошибка в сборке ядра  (Прочитано 895 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Master-of-deaD

  • Автор темы
  • Новичок
  • *
  • Сообщений: 40
    • Просмотр профиля
Ошибка в сборке ядра
« : 27 Декабря 2008, 00:14:59 »
  CC [M]  ubuntu/tlsup/tlsup_hotkeys.o
  CC [M]  ubuntu/tlsup/tlsup_radios.o
ubuntu/tlsup/tlsup_radios.c: В функции ‘tlsup_radio_switch_set’:
ubuntu/tlsup/tlsup_radios.c:176: ошибка: неявная декларация функции ‘msleep’
make[3]: *** [ubuntu/tlsup/tlsup_radios.o] Ошибка 1
make[2]: *** [ubuntu/tlsup] Ошибка 2
make[1]: *** [ubuntu] Ошибка 2
make[1]: Выход из каталога `/usr/src/linux-source-2.6.27'
make: *** [debian/stamp-build-kernel] Ошибка 2

Всем привет. Вот привёл то, что пишет в конце сборки. Собирал в первый, сделал уже много разных попыток, но всё равно в результате это.
Материал о том как собирать брал отсюда https://forum.ubuntu.ru/index.php?topic=18414.0 Если брать исходное ядро и не вносить в него изменений, то собирает. Если вносить, то приводит такую ошибку. Подскажите пожалуйста, в чём дело. Буду признателен. Поиск юзал, но особо ничего не нашёл, может критерий поиска неверный, но вроде нормально

Оффлайн Theif

  • Активист
  • *
  • Сообщений: 262
  • Идейный пингвин
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#1 : 27 Декабря 2008, 10:23:01 »
конфиг откуда берешь?

Оффлайн mkarasik

  • Участник
  • *
  • Сообщений: 163
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#2 : 27 Декабря 2008, 17:59:36 »
Автор вопроса занимался когда нибудь программированием? Решений у проблеммы много, как минимум об;явить мслееп явно ну или воткнуть заголовок куда нибудь. Была у меня такая ошибка, при изменении конфига исключается заголовок из компиляции.

Меня больше интересует вопрос, зачем лезть в компиляцию ядра, если элементарная ошибка вводит в ступор?

Добавь куда нибудь

#include <linux/delay.h>

ну или другой какой если я ошибся
« Последнее редактирование: 27 Декабря 2008, 18:03:57 от mkarasik »

Оффлайн Master-of-deaD

  • Автор темы
  • Новичок
  • *
  • Сообщений: 40
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#3 : 27 Декабря 2008, 18:50:22 »
Вы уж извините, но программированием не занимался. Почему лезу? Просто мне интересно таким заниматься. Это достаточно увлекательно и в тоже время познавательно. К тому же позволяет больше понять как работает линукс и прочее.
P.S. В общем вопрос решил. Всем спасибо за ответы

Оффлайн ende_neu

  • Старожил
  • *
  • Сообщений: 2473
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#4 : 27 Декабря 2008, 19:00:44 »
И как решил?Решение в студию,может пригодится.

Оффлайн Theif

  • Активист
  • *
  • Сообщений: 262
  • Идейный пингвин
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#5 : 27 Декабря 2008, 19:04:11 »
<telepat_mode>выключил опцию в ядре</telepat_mode>

Оффлайн Master-of-deaD

  • Автор темы
  • Новичок
  • *
  • Сообщений: 40
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#6 : 27 Декабря 2008, 19:36:31 »
Ну тут даже и телепат режим не нужен))) Именно что-то лишнее выключил думаю. но с другой стороны почти ничего и не отключал, даже и не знаю, что это я мог такое выключить. Англ более-менее знаю, описание читал, ничего важного не отрубал, но всё ж, когда решил совсем поминимуму отключать, уж чисто для интереса, то собралось. Но всё равно подозрительно. Так как я знаю люди куда больше отключают и всё собирает. В общем бум учить матчасть)

Оффлайн mkarasik

  • Участник
  • *
  • Сообщений: 163
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#7 : 31 Декабря 2008, 20:22:56 »
НУ вы и клоуны блин. Решение в моем посте выше. Одна или несколько опций в конфигурации выкидывают явное определение функции мслееп. Так вот нужно ее определить, что такое функция и ее определение не ко мне. Если в программирование не шарите, то либо включайтев все обратно, потом отключайте по одному и жалуйтесь на кернел орг, когда поломается. Потом качайте патч, в котором будет строчка из моего предидущего поста, и ставьте себе.

Оффлайн SauronTheDark

  • Активист
  • *
  • Сообщений: 674
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#8 : 31 Декабря 2008, 20:56:27 »
А когда в Kernel Hacking добавят опцию Telepath mode support ?

tartan

  • Гость
Re: Ошибка в сборке ядра
« Ответ #9 : 31 Декабря 2008, 21:04:37 »
Карасег, пересобери моск с поддержкой русского языка, клоун блин.

Оффлайн mkarasik

  • Участник
  • *
  • Сообщений: 163
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#10 : 01 Января 2009, 17:23:25 »
А что неправильно в моем мозгу или в поддержке русского языка относительно поставленного вопроса?

tartan

  • Гость
Re: Ошибка в сборке ядра
« Ответ #11 : 01 Января 2009, 18:06:41 »
man падежи
man ы

И мушку надо бы спилить, да.

Оффлайн mkarasik

  • Участник
  • *
  • Сообщений: 163
    • Просмотр профиля
Re: Ошибка в сборке ядра
« Ответ #12 : 01 Января 2009, 23:03:49 »
Если проблемма только в падежах и Ы, то ладно

 

Страница сгенерирована за 0.065 секунд. Запросов: 23.